David was the son of David Tenny Jr. and Margaret Gates Tenney of Columbia. She was the daughter of George Tenney of Columbia.

Married his cousin Abigail B. Tinney Sept 16, 1853 Columbia Maine (alternate spelling Tenney) . Abigail was the daughter of Joseph Fenno Tenny and first wife Mehitable Hughes (alternate spelling Huse); Joseph being a brother to Margaret Gates Tenney first above.

In the 1860 census David was 28, residinng in Dennysville Maine and was a carpenter. Abigial was 23 and they had children Frederick P. age 5 and Alba E. age 3.

Enlisted from Dennysville May 1, 1861, age 29 and married, discharged for disability Aug 30, 1862. Member Co J, 6th div Infantry. David was a laborer.

Maine Veteran's Record David J. Tenney, born March 5, 1832 Columbia, died Feb 3, 1881, buried Town Cemetery #1. enlisted Feb 1865 discharged Aug 28, 1865, co E, 14th Infantry, Maine Volunteers, GAR marker and flag, has monument stone.

By 1870 the family had returned to Columbia Falls and David and Abigail had children Fred age 15, Abbie age 14, cora age 10, Robert age 6 and David age 4.

In 1880 David was 49, a laborer, and wife Abigail B. was 43. In the household at that time were children Cora A. age 19, Robert P. age 16, and David A. age 13.

Wife Abigail married at least two more times; in 1894 she married John T. Allen. She married Edward B. Owen in June of 1904. He later died that year in September and was buried in Forest Hill Cemetery in Pembroke with first wife Deborah. Abigail Owen died in Columbia Falls July 28, 1906, widow of Edward B. Owen and daughter of Fenno Tenney. She died of nephritis and death record does not indicate where she was buried.
